Whether you love them or hate them, it was rather disappointing to hear that the Manchester Christmas Markets were cancelled this year due to COVID-19, and even with a couple of smaller alternatives popping up in Piccadilly Gardens and St Ann’s Square – the city seems a whole lot less ‘Christmassy’.

This is, of course, all understandable considering the fact that we’re in Tier 3 and you can’t even go into a boozer for a pint, so the city’s independents have had to re-think and adapt their offerings to survive.

So, low and behold, independent Spanish restaurant La Bandera have launched their very own Christmas Markets, where you can order and collect an impressive range of food, drinks, hampers and gifts.

Head on over to their website and you can order a range of impressive hampers, with their Ibéricos Hamper (£24.95); filled with a selection of the best Spanish Ibérico cured meats with marinated olives, roasted almonds and fried corn, their Artisan Cheese Hamper (£24.95); with 4 fantastic artisan Spanish cheeses with crackers, homemade fig jam and onion chutney.

Finally there’s their Spanish Delicatessen Hamper (£26.95) with Jamón Ibérico (Iberian Ham), Chorizo, 2 Artisan Spanish Cheeses, Olives, Crackers and Homemade Onion Chutney.

With your choice of hamper, you can pick a bottle of fantastic Spanish wine sourced from small-batch independent wineries, or even better – a bottle of Cava. Or for an extra £24.95 you can choose La Bandera’s optional WINE FLIGHT – 4 specially selected and paired wines that go perfectly with everything in your hamper.

Talking of booze and wine, La Bandera offer up a truly excellent selection of independent wines from Spain and the Canary Islands – a consequence of having one of the best wine lists of any restaurant in the city. Where else in the city can you get a bottle of the outstandingly complex Tajinaste 2017 (£42), grown on the volcanic slopes of North Tenerife?

La Bandera’s Christmas Market also features their brand-new Menu de Navidad – their Spanish Christmas Tapas Menus.

With two options available for collection, there’s the £25pp option with Appetisers and 5 tapas to share, or you go more extravagant for £34pp with Appetisers, a cheese and meat board, and 6 tapas including; Homemade Turkey Croquettes, Grilled King Prawns with Aioli Sauce, Christmas Sliders with Chorizo and Goat Cheese, Beef Stew, Twice Cooked Octopus and Carrilleras de Cerdo – slow cooked Iberian Pork Cheeks in a PX Wine Sauce.

There are also plans to start offering up a range of gifts, including a Paella Kit (£19.95), Sangria Kit and Churros at Home Kit – all great for presents or just if you want to re-create a Spanish holiday at home.
